Building Your First Code Snippet

Create, document, and publish a production-quality automation script to the community library.

Step 1: Identify a Task to Automate

Look for repetitive tasks in your daily workflow:

  • Renaming files in bulk
  • Converting between data formats
  • Sending templated emails
  • Processing spreadsheets
  • Scraping data from websites

For this tutorial, we'll build a JSON to CSV converter.

Step 2: Write Clean Code

import json
import csv
from pathlib import Path
from typing import Optional


def json_to_csv(
    input_file: str,
    output_file: Optional[str] = None,
    delimiter: str = ",",
) -> dict:
    """
    Convert a JSON array file to CSV format.

    Args:
        input_file: Path to the JSON file (must contain a list of objects).
        output_file: Output CSV path. Defaults to same name with .csv extension.
        delimiter: CSV delimiter character.

    Returns:
        Dict with conversion stats.

    Raises:
        ValueError: If JSON doesn't contain a list of objects.
    """
    input_path = Path(input_file)
    if not input_path.exists():
        raise FileNotFoundError(f"File not found: {input_file}")

    with open(input_path, encoding="utf-8") as f:
        data = json.load(f)

    if not isinstance(data, list) or not data:
        raise ValueError("JSON must contain a non-empty array of objects")

    if output_file is None:
        output_file = str(input_path.with_suffix(".csv"))

    headers = list(data[0].keys())

    with open(output_file, "w", newline="", encoding="utf-8") as f:
        writer = csv.DictWriter(f, fieldnames=headers, delimiter=delimiter)
        writer.writeheader()
        writer.writerows(data)

    return {
        "input": input_file,
        "output": output_file,
        "rows": len(data),
        "columns": len(headers),
    }

Step 3: Add Error Handling

Always handle edge cases:

  • File not found
  • Invalid JSON format
  • Empty data arrays
  • Encoding issues
  • Permission errors

Step 4: Test Thoroughly

if __name__ == "__main__":
    # Test with sample data
    result = json_to_csv("sample_data.json")
    print(f"Converted: {result['rows']} rows, {result['columns']} columns")
    print(f"Output: {result['output']}")
